Understanding the Basics: Brightness and Contrast

To understand how images are perceived and displayed, it’s essential to grasp the basics of brightness and contrast. Brightness controls how light or dark your screen appears, affecting overall visibility. Contrast, on the other hand, determines the difference between the darkest blacks and brightest whites, impacting image depth. Proper color calibration ensures these settings work harmoniously, providing accurate color representation and clarity. Screen resolution also plays a role by defining how sharp and detailed images look, which influences how brightness and contrast are perceived. How Brightness Affects Your Viewing Experience

Brightness directly influences how easily you can see details on your screen. If it’s too high, screen glare can become overwhelming, making it harder to focus and causing discomfort. Excessive glare reflects off the screen, straining your eyes and increasing fatigue during long viewing sessions. Conversely, if brightness is too low, you might struggle to distinguish details, especially in well-lit environments. Proper brightness settings help balance visibility without overwhelming your eyes. Adjusting brightness to match your surroundings reduces eye strain and improves overall viewing comfort. Remember, ideal brightness isn’t just about brightness levels—it’s about finding the right balance to prevent glare and keep your eyes relaxed. When you get it right, your screen becomes clearer, more comfortable, and less tiring to look at over time. Overlooking Ambient Light
Ignoring ambient light conditions can lead to poor display adjustments that strain your eyes or reduce visibility. When you neglect ambient lighting, your display’s brightness and contrast may not match your environment, making it harder to see details or causing eye fatigue. Proper sensor calibration ensures your screen responds correctly to ambient lighting changes, maintaining ideal visibility. Without accounting for ambient lighting, you might set brightness too high in a dark room or too low in bright conditions, defeating the purpose of fine-tuning your display. Always evaluate your environment before adjusting settings. Use sensors or calibration tools to help automate this process, ensuring your display adapts seamlessly. Overlooking ambient light is a common mistake that hampers your viewing experience and can lead to unnecessary eye strain.

Relying on Defaults
Relying on default display settings is a common mistake that can compromise your viewing experience. Factory calibration aims to maximize screens out of the box, but it doesn’t suit every environment or personal preference. Default settings often prioritize general appeal over accuracy, leading to overly bright images or washed-out contrast. If you stick with these defaults, you might miss out on ideal brightness and contrast adjustments that enhance detail and reduce eye strain. Instead, take time to calibrate your display based on your specific lighting conditions and use case. Customizing these settings ensures you’re not just relying on factory calibration but actively tailoring your screen for better clarity, color accuracy, and overall comfort. The Interplay Between Brightness and Contrast

Brightness and contrast work together to influence how images appear, but they often require balancing to achieve the desired effect. Adjusting one impacts the other, affecting your color gamut and overall visual comfort. Too much brightness can wash out details, while excessive contrast may distort colors or cause eye strain. Finding the right balance enhances image clarity without sacrificing color accuracy. Consider your ambient lighting—brighter settings might need lower contrast to prevent eye fatigue. Pay attention to how your screen’s contrast affects the color palette, ensuring details stay visible without overwhelming your eyes. Proper interplay maintains visual harmony, prevents color distortion, and reduces eye strain, making your viewing experience more comfortable and vibrant. Practical Steps for Optimal Screen Calibration

To achieve the best image quality, you need to calibrate your screen effectively. Begin with color calibration by using a calibration tool or software to ensure accurate color reproduction. Adjust hardware settings such as brightness, contrast, and backlight to match your environment and reduce eye strain. Use built-in display menus to fine-tune these settings, ensuring shadows and highlights are balanced. For more precise results, consider using a hardware calibration device that measures your display’s output directly. Regularly re-calibrate, especially if you notice color shifts or display inconsistencies. Keep your monitor’s firmware updated to improve calibration accuracy. Troubleshooting Common Display Issues

When your display starts acting up, identifying the root cause quickly can save you time and frustration. Start by checking your color calibration; inaccurate settings can cause color distortions or flickering. If colors look off or inconsistent, recalibrate your display using the appropriate tools. Next, examine your refresh rate—an incompatible or low refresh rate can result in ghosting or screen tearing. Adjust the refresh rate in your display settings to match the recommended specifications for your monitor. Also, make sure your graphics drivers are up to date, as outdated drivers can cause display issues. If problems persist, test with another cable or port, since faulty connections can mimic more complex issues. Troubleshooting these core areas often resolves common display problems efficiently.
